Watch These Johnson & Johnson Price Levels After Stock’s Post-Earnings Pop
Key Takeaways
- Johnson & Johnson shares fell slightly Thursday after soaring yesterday amid investor optimism about the company’s better-than-expected earnings and full-year outlook.
- The stock rallied above key moving averages and a symmetrical triangle in Wednesday’s trading session, though it remains in a long-term trading range.
- Investors should watch crucial overhead areas on J&J’s chart around $168 and $180, while also monitoring major support levels near $155 and $145.
Johnson & Johnson (JNJ) shares lost ground Thursday after soaring yesterday amid investor optimism about the company’s better-than-expected earnings and full-year outlook.
